Lock Cylinder
A lock cylinder can be found on a upvc u-shaped door. It allows you to lock or unlock the door using the key. It is available in a variety of different kinds of locks, like deadbolts, padlocks, and lever or knob locks. Cylinders come in a variety of sizes and styles, and they can be interchangeable to change the key system of doors that are locked. Cylinders also come with a variety of security features that help stop unauthorized entry. These include antibumping, antipicking and antidrilling technology.
A cylinder lock is built with a set of pins held in place by springs. They are arranged in such a way that they align with the ridges on the standard key. When the right key has been inserted, the pin pairs rise enough to let the cylinder to turn. This is called the shearline, and is what makes locks so secure.
If a lock is defective it is usually a sign of that there is a problem with the cylinder. A common symptom is the inability to insert or remove the key from the lock. This could be a sign of a broken pin or shear line which can lead to a broken lock.

The most well-known type of cylinder is the pin tumbler, which is used in many types of locks. This kind of cylinder is made up of pins which are held in tension by springs. They are arranged so that only the appropriate key can move them. It is also constructed of hardened steel to protect against from tampering and other types of attack.
The disc tumbler is a second type of cylinder that uses wafers stacked so that the key must align properly to open the lock. This type of cylinder offers more security than the pin tumbler and is a good choice for homeowners who want to improve their home's security.
